Question

Which technique is used for separating colloidal particles from small ions using a cellophane and collodion?

The correct answer is

Dialysis

Understanding Separation Techniques for Colloids

The question asks about a specific technique used to separate colloidal particles from smaller particles like ions. This separation method uses a special membrane, such as one made from cellophane or collodion.

Let's look at the options provided and understand what each technique involves:

  • Diffusion: This is the movement of particles from an area of higher concentration to an area of lower concentration. While it involves movement of particles, it's not primarily used for separating colloids from ions using a membrane based on size differences in this context.
  • Dialysis: This is a process that utilizes a semi-permeable membrane. This membrane has pores that are large enough to allow small ions, solvent molecules, and smaller solute particles to pass through, but too small to allow larger colloidal particles to escape. When a solution containing colloidal particles and small ions is placed inside a bag made of this membrane and immersed in pure solvent (like water), the small ions and solvent molecules can move across the membrane, while the colloidal particles are retained inside the bag. This process effectively purifies the colloid by removing the small impurities. Cellophane and collodion are common materials used for such membranes.
  • Osmosis: This is the movement of solvent molecules across a semi-permeable membrane from a region of lower solute concentration to a region of higher solute concentration. It's mainly about solvent flow driven by concentration differences, not about separating different types of solute particles based on size.
  • Viscosity: This is a physical property of a fluid that measures its resistance to flow. It is not a technique used for separating components of a mixture.

Why Dialysis is the Correct Technique

Based on the description in the question – separating colloidal particles from small ions using a semi-permeable membrane like cellophane or collodion – the technique that fits perfectly is Dialysis. It is the standard method for purifying colloidal solutions by removing crystallizable impurities (small ions, small molecules) which can pass through the membrane, while the colloidal particles are retained.

Therefore, Dialysis is the technique specifically designed for this type of separation based on the size of particles relative to the pore size of the semi-permeable membrane.
